The epoxidation of some androsta-4,6-dienes with m-chloroperbenzoic acid has been shown to give the 4β, 5β; 6α, 7α-diepoxides, the stereochemistry can be rationalized in terms of the directing effect of one epoxide on the facial selectivity of the second epoxidation.
